How they compare
Republic of Korea currently reports 40.59 kg/ha against 39.98 kg/ha in Rwanda, a difference of 0.61 kg/ha.
The two have swapped places 7 times across 63 shared years of data; in 1961 it was Rwanda ahead.
Republic of Korea ranks 35th and Rwanda ranks 37th of 186 countries.
Across the 7 decades both report, Republic of Korea averaged higher in 6 and Rwanda in 1.
Head to head by decade
| Decade | Republic of Korea | Rwanda |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 26.94 kg/ha | 27.02 kg/ha | 0.0846 kg/ha | Rwanda |
| 1970s | 35.02 kg/ha | 29.83 kg/ha | 5.19 kg/ha | Republic of Korea |
| 1980s | 36.07 kg/ha | 32.42 kg/ha | 3.65 kg/ha | Republic of Korea |
| 1990s | 36.91 kg/ha | 30.28 kg/ha | 6.63 kg/ha | Republic of Korea |
| 2000s | 39.65 kg/ha | 32.93 kg/ha | 6.72 kg/ha | Republic of Korea |
| 2010s | 39.05 kg/ha | 34.25 kg/ha | 4.8 kg/ha | Republic of Korea |
| 2020s | 40 kg/ha | 37.38 kg/ha | 2.62 kg/ha | Republic of Korea |
Averages of every year both report within each decade.

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
